Lot description:


Constantius II AR Siliqua. Lugdunum, AD 360-363. D N CONSTANTIVS P F AVG, pearl-diademed, draped and cuirassed bust to right / VOTIS XXX MVLTIS XXXX in four lines within wreath with jewel at apex; LVG in exergue. RIC VIII 216; RSC 342-3a. 1.79g, 19mm, 6h.

Extremely Fine; minor flan crack, pleasantly toned.

From a scattered hoard found in West Norfolk, Thursday 1st October 2015 - Friday 23rd October 2015. Submitted for consideration as Treasure, and returned to the finders. PAS ID: NMS-102704.
